4. Combined cycle
The differences between a combined cycle fuelled by natural gas and a combined cycle fuelled by syngas from gasification are mainly :
characteristics of the fuel used (composition, calorific value, etc.) ;
NO x reduction techniques;
the combustion turbine, which must be suitable for syngas operation; it must also be able to extract air from its compressor to feed the pressurized air separation unit; some combustion turbines do not offer this facility;
the steam produced in the gasification and gas treatment section is injected into the water-steam cycle of the IGCC combined cycle.
